Comprehensive Oral Health

The Division of Comprehensive Oral Health works seamlessly across multiple specialties to ensure patients experience frictionless oral health care treatment. This collaborative team of oral health care professionals diagnoses and treats defects, restoring and promoting improved oral and overall health.

Expert faculty in dental hygiene, comprehensive dentistry, endodontics, operative dentistry and biomaterials, periodontics and prosthodontics lead the division.

The interdisciplinary team works closely with the GO Health Center, NC Missions of Mercy Clinics, NC Baptist Mobile Dental Unit, Wake County Smiles and more.

Supporting Endodontics

Funds Supporting Professorships

Endowed professorships allow the recruitment and retention of the very best clinicians, educators and researchers in the field of endodontics. Once endowed, they provide support for salary, research and other professional activities directed at fulfilling our mission.

Graduate Education Funds

Graduate education funds are used to support specialty education in endodontics. One hundred percent of gifts to the graduate education fellowship funds is directed to support resident stipends and educational opportunities.

Division Funds

Division funds help enhance the division’s programs and resources, and the division as a whole.
